This class is all about two things: Learning how to use the basics of your flash on the camera and how (and why) to take the flash off the camera.
Join Hunt’s Photo Educator Emily Hojnowski as we discuss how to take pictures using a speedlight, and make them look great, no matter what the situation. We will discuss photographing people, but also photographing product and how flashes work. We’ll talk all about the basics, including modes, settings, and more!
Whether you own a flash and have no idea how to use it, you want to take great photos at functions and family events that are in low light, or you just want to learn how to add a flash into your repertoire, this course is for you!
